Porto Canale Leonardesco is the soul of Cesenatico, a masterpiece of engineering designed by Leonardo da Vinci in 1502. The canal serves as a living museum where traditional sailing vessels with brightly colored sails are moored alongside a working fishing fleet. Visitors can stroll along the scenic boardwalks, which are lined with vibrant architecture, cozy cafes, and highly-rated seafood restaurants. The area offers a rich cultural experience, including an open-air maritime museum and access to the town's old village, which hosts lively markets in the evenings. Whether you are interested in maritime history or simply looking for a picturesque spot for an evening walk, the canal provides a quintessential and relaxing Italian coastal experience.

Porto Canale Leonardesco is celebrated by visitors as the crown jewel of Cesenatico, offering a beautiful and relaxing environment for all ages. Reviewers are consistently impressed by the historical sailing boats and the unique canal architecture designed by Leonardo da Vinci. The area is frequently described as a perfect spot for an evening walk, complemented by a variety of high-quality seafood restaurants and cozy cafes. Many guests highlight the charm of the 'floating museum' and the vibrant atmosphere created by the evening markets. While some mention that dining directly on the canal can be slightly expensive, the overall sentiment is overwhelmingly positive regarding the scenery and cultural value. It remains a top recommendation for families and photography enthusiasts seeking an authentic Italian experience.
